What is the difference between context and siteContext?

0

The ‘siteContext’ is used to provide extra information (e.g., a category, the title of a page etc.) that can be used to augment the ‘context’. Similar to ‘context’ you can put in a few words, a sentence (e.g., a title of an article), a paragraph of text, or an abstract plus title of an article.
